Do proper research before real estate investing. Check out a lot of properties, up to 100, in the location you're thinking of, and be sure to take some notes. On the spreadsheet list the price, necessary repairs and expected rental income. You will easily see which properties are good investments and which are not.

A fixer-upper may be cheap, but think about how much you have to renovate to bring it up in value. If the property only needs cosmetic upgrades, it may be a good investment. However, major structural problems can very costly to fix. In the long-run, it may not give you a good return on your investment.

Any tenant you're thinking of renting to must be screened thoroughly. All too often, irresponsible and unreliable tenants do extensive damage to the property and are always behind in rent. Before you accept a tenant, get references and check their criminal history and credit. This will help you make sure your tenants are dependable.

Do not sign any contracts to buy a piece of land before you do your research carefully to confirm the ownership of the land. Hire your own surveyor to identify the property lines clearly. This prevents misrepresentation of the piece of property for sale, and it mitigates any future problems.

As an investor, be very picky about the properties you will invest in. This means that before you even consider making an offer, you take the time to thoroughly inspect the property. To be even more on the safe side, hire a professional inspector to perform a walk-through and ensure the property is structurally sound.

Operation Home! seeks property partners


Consider a person who has had stable employment for years, but their employer closes their doors for good, laying off the entire workforce. A rent increase of $200 a month for a senior on a fixed Social Security income. An unexpected illness that causes a person to not be able to work and sends them into a debt spiral of medical bills they cannot afford to pay. A household losing the primary income earner. These are just a few examples of situations that can cause or exacerbate episodes of homelessness in our community.



Through an initiative called Operation Home! a coalition of agencies is assisting people experiencing homelessness with rental assistance and supportive services. A key component to the success of the program is the need to secure ongoing partnerships with property partners, like homeowners, property managers, investors and developers to access affordable vacant units quickly.



Operation Home! is a community-wide effort designed to quickly and permanently house community members in Southern Nevada, who need a home. Local government partners include Clark County, city of Las Vegas, city of Henderson and city of North Las Vegas, which are working closely with a regional coalition that includes numerous service provider organizations, faith-based groups and corporate partners. All have come together to address Southern Nevada’s housing crisis under the auspices of Operation Home!



Along with providing rental assistance this program provides client-centered planning in conjunction with support services that include tenant specific case management, assistance with coordinating medical care such as physical and mental health services, behavioral health treatment and assisting people with regaining access to employment.



The demand for affordable rental homes has exceeded the current supply due to rising property values.

Bear Real Estate Advisors Represents Cypress West Partners in Acquisition of Las Vegas Medical Office Building Portfolio


LAS VEGAS, March 21, 2022 /PRNewswire/ -- Bear Real Estate Advisors, a national investment services firm, announced today its representation of Cypress West Partners in the acquisition of a four-building, multi-tenant medical office building portfolio in the Las Vegas suburb of Henderson, Nevada. Total sale price for the portfolio totaled $17.1 million.



"Medical office buildings are prized among real estate investors as they are historically among the most stable asset types," said Matt Bear, founder and chief executive officer of Bear Real Estate Advisors. "Wigwam Professional Center is ideally located in the densely populated and affluent Green Valley neighborhood of Greater Las Vegas, where demand for healthcare services continues to grow along with the population."



Built between 1998 and 2002, the portfolio totals approximately 50,000 square feet and is 100% leased. Located at 2500, 2510, 2625 and 2649 Wigwam Parkway, the portfolio is located in close proximity to Parkway Surgery Center and St. Rose Dominican Hospital, with convenient access to Interstate 215.



Chris Cumella, partner with Cypress West, added, "Acquiring the Wigwam Professional Center furthers our aspiration of being the premier medical investor in the Las Vegas Valley. This property fits our unique skill set of building relationships with the local medical practitioners and providing risk-adjusted return to our investors. We appreciate Bear's knowledge of our investment objectives, and for being a trusted source to help us reach our company's goals."
